How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sepulveda?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sepulveda Pet Friendly Studio Apartments | $1,657 | $800 | $2,220 |
| Sepulveda Pet Friendly 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,012 | $1,040 | $2,810 |
| Sepulveda Pet Friendly 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,749 | $966 | $8,732 |
| Sepulveda Pet Friendly 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,391 | $2,575 | $10,000+ |
| Sepulveda Pet Friendly 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,152 | $2,986 | $5,900 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Sepulveda Apartments
What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in Sepulveda?
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in Sepulveda is at Mission Gateway listed at $966.
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Sepulveda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Sepulveda is $2,454.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Sepulveda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Sepulveda is a 1,759 square feet unit starting from $3,295 at Almeria Townhomes.
What is the average size for Sepulveda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Sepulveda is currently at 764 sq ft.
